Wood window services encompass a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ring traditional wooden windows. These services often include assessments of window condition, repairs to damaged or rotting wood, and refinishing or repainting to enhance appearance and durability. Skilled professionals can address issues such as cracked sashes, deteriorated frames, or broken muntins, helping to restore the window’s original function and aesthetic appeal. Proper maintenance and repair can extend the lifespan of wooden windows, preserving their historical charm or enhancing the character of a property.

Many common problems that lead property owners to seek wood window services involve issues related to weather exposure and aging. Over time, wood can suffer from rot, warping, or insect damage, which can compromise the window’s structural integrity and energy efficiency. Dr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and increased energy costs are often signs that repairs or replacements are needed. Service providers can also assist with addressing paint or finish deterioration, which not only affects appearance but can also accelerate wood decay if left untreated.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Naperville,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a single wood window typ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and style. Full window replacements in homes can cost between $2,000 and $5,000 for multiple units.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ific project details.

Repair Expenses - Repairing wood window components such as sashes or frames usually falls between $150 and $500 per window. Costs vary with the extent of damage and whether parts need to be custom-made. Contact local pros for assessments tailored to individual repair needs.

Refinishing and Restoration - Restoring a wood window’s finish, including sanding and repainting, generally costs between $200 and $600 per window. This process can help preserve the wood and improve appearance without full replacement. Local specialists can offer detailed quotes based on the scope of work.

Additional Service Fees - Extra costs may include removing old windows, disposal, or special hardware, typically adding $50 to $200 per window. These fees depend on the project complexity and service provider policies. Contact local contractors to explore specific cost considerations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of repairs are available for wood windows? Local service providers can handle a variety of wood window repairs, including sash replacement, rotted wood repair, and hardware restoration.

Can wood windows be restored instead of replaced? Yes, many local pros offer restoration services to repair and preserve existing wood windows, extending their lifespan.

What are common signs that wood windows need service? Signs include rotting wood, difficulty opening or closing, drafts, and visible damage or warping.

Are there maintenance services available for wood windows? Maintenance services such as sealing, painting, and weatherstripping are often provided to help protect and maintain wood windows.

How do local pros handle wood window upgrades? Upgrades may include installing energy-efficient glazing, adding weatherproofing, or enhancing window hardware for improved performance.
